  • Patent number: 9151226
    Abstract: A corrugated shield comprises a mounting base and a corrugated ring section. The mounting base is disposed at an aft end of the ring section for securing the shield ring section within a generally annular cavity. The generally annular cavity is defined at least in part by a hot fluid flow path boundary wall, and a radially adjacent and spaced apart cold fluid flow path boundary wall. The corrugated ring section is configured to substantially block a line of sight between the hot fluid flow path boundary wall and the cold fluid flow path boundary wall.

  • Patent number: 9022728
    Abstract: A vane segment for a gas turbine engine includes an airfoil disposed between an outer platform and an inner platform. A slot for receiving a seal is defined within the outer platform and includes closed first and second ends and an upper surface spaced apart from a lower surface with a spacing between the upper surface and the lower surfaces that varies along a length of the slot.
